Q: What should we wear for the stargazing tour? Is it really cold at night?

A: Good question, Sam! Zion can get quite chilly at night, especially if you’re lying on the ground to look up. I'd recommend wearing layers—think a warm jacket, hats, and gloves. They usually have blankets available, but it’s better to bring your own for extra warmth.

Q: How do we get there? Is parking easy at the location?

A: Hey Emily! Parking at the stargazing location by the Virgin River is usually pretty good, but it can fill up on weekends. I’d recommend getting there about 30 minutes early to grab a good spot. The tour starts right after sunset, so plan accordingly!
